M5STACK -LOGOTIKAS

M5STACK M5Core2 V1.1 ESP32 IoT kūrimo rinkinys

M5STACK-M5Core2-V1.1-ESP32 IoT Development-Kit-PRODUCT

Informacija apie produktą

Metai 2020
Versija V0.01

Kontūras
M5Core2 1.1 yra ESP32 plokštė, pagrįsta ESP32-D0WDQ6-V3 lustu ir turi 2 colių TFT ekraną. Plokštė pagaminta iš PC+ABC.M5STACK-M5Core2-V1.1-ESP32 IoT Development-Kit-FIG-1

Aparatūros sudėtis
CORE2 aparatinės įrangos komponentai apima

  • ESP32-D0WDQ6-V3 lustas
  • TFT ekranas
  • Žalias šviesos diodas
  • Mygtukas
  • GROVE sąsaja
  • TypeC-USB sąsaja
  • Maitinimo valdymo lustas
  • Baterija

ESP32-D0WDQ6-V3 lustas yra dviejų branduolių sistema su dviem Harvard Architecture Xtensa LX6 procesoriais. Jis turi įterptąją atmintį, išorinę atmintį ir periferinius įrenginius, esančius šių procesorių duomenų magistralėje ir (arba) komandų magistralėje. Dviejų procesorių adresų atvaizdavimas yra simetriškas, išskyrus kai kurias nedideles išimtis. Keli sistemos periferiniai įrenginiai gali pasiekti įterptąją atmintį per DMA.

TFT ekranas
TFT ekranas yra 2 colių spalvotas ILI9342C ekranas, kurio skiriamoji geba yra 320 x 240. Jis veikia esant tūriuitage diapazonas yra 2.6–3.3 V, o darbinės temperatūros diapazonas –10–5 °C.

Energijos valdymo lustas
Naudojamas maitinimo valdymo lustas yra X-Powers AXP192. Jis veikia iš įvesties ttag2.9 V–6.3 V diapazonas ir palaiko 1.4 A įkrovimo srovę.

Funkcinis aprašymas
Šiame skyriuje aprašomi įvairūs ESP32-D0WDQ6-V3 lusto moduliai ir funkcijos.

CPU ir atmintis
ESP32-D0WDQ6-V3 lustas turi Xtensa vieno / dviejų branduolių 32 bitų LX6 mikroprocesorius, kurių didžiausias greitis yra iki 600 MIPS. CPU turi 448 KB ROM, 520 KB SRAM ir papildomai 16 KB SRAM RTC. Jis palaiko kelis „flash“ / SRAM lustus per QSPI.

Sandėliavimo aprašymas

  • ESP32 palaiko kelias išorines QSPI blykstes ir statinę laisvosios kreipties atmintį (SRAM) su aparatine AES šifravimu, skirtu vartotojo programų ir duomenų apsaugai.
  • ESP32 prieiga prie išorinės QSPI Flash ir SRAM per talpyklą. Jis gali susieti iki 16 MB išorinės „Flash“ kodo vietos į centrinį procesorių, palaikydamas 8 bitų, 16 bitų ir 32 bitų prieigą ir kodo vykdymą. Jis taip pat gali susieti iki 8 MB išorinės „Flash“ ir SRAM su procesoriaus duomenų erdve, palaikydamas 8 bitų, 16 bitų ir 32 bitų prieigą. „Flash“ palaiko tik skaitymo operacijas, o SRAM palaiko ir skaitymo, ir rašymo operacijas.

PIN kodo APRAŠYMAS

USB SĄSAJA
M5CAMREA konfigūracija C tipo USB sąsaja, palaiko USB2.0 standartinį ryšio protokolą.M5STACK-M5Core2-V1.1-ESP32 IoT Development-Kit-FIG-2
GROVE SĄSAJA
4p disponuotas 2.0 mm M5CAMREA GROVE sąsajų žingsnis, vidinis laidas ir prijungtas GND, 5V, GPIO32, GPIO33.M5STACK-M5Core2-V1.1-ESP32 IoT Development-Kit-FIG-3

 FUNKCIJOS APRAŠYMAS

Šiame skyriuje aprašomi įvairūs ESP32-D0WDQ6-V3 moduliai ir funkcijos.

CPU IR ATMINTIS
Xtensa vieno / dviejų branduolių 32 bitų LX6 mikroprocesorius (-ai), iki 600 MIPS (200 MIPS, skirtas ESP32-S0WD / ESP32-U4WDH, 400 MIPS ESP32-D2WD)

  • 448 KB ROM
  • 520 KB SRAM
  • 16 KB SRAM RTC
  • QSPI palaiko kelis „flash“ / SRAM lustus

LAIKYMO APRAŠYMAS

Išorinė blykstė ir SRAM
ESP32 palaiko kelias išorines QSPI blykstes ir statinę laisvosios kreipties atmintį (SRAM), turinčią aparatinės įrangos AES šifravimą, kad apsaugotų vartotojo programas ir duomenis.

  • ESP32 prieiga prie išorinės QSPI Flash ir SRAM talpykloje. Iki 16 MB išorinės „Flash“ kodo vietos yra susietos su CPU, palaiko 8 bitų, 16 bitų ir 32 bitų prieigą ir gali vykdyti kodą.
  • Iki 8 MB išorinės „Flash“ ir SRAM, susietos su procesoriaus duomenų erdve, 8 bitų, 16 bitų ir 32 bitų prieigos palaikymas. „Flash“ palaiko tik skaitymo operacijas, SRAM – skaitymo ir rašymo operacijas.

KRISTALAS
Išorinis 2 MHz ~ 60 MHz kristalų generatorius (40 MHz tik Wi-Fi/BT funkcijai)

RTC VALDYMAS IR MAŽAS ENERGIJOS VARTOJIMAS
ESP32 naudoja pažangias energijos valdymo technologijas, gali būti perjungiamas tarp skirtingų energijos taupymo režimų. (Žr. 5 lentelę).

Energijos taupymo režimas

  • Aktyvus režimas: veikia RF lustas. Lustas gali priimti ir perduoti garsinį signalą.
  • Modemo miego režimas: CPU gali veikti, laikrodis gali būti sukonfigūruotas. „Wi-Fi“ / „Bluetooth“ pagrindinė juosta ir RF
  • Lengvo miego režimas: CPU sustabdytas. RTC ir atminties bei periferinių įrenginių ULP koprocesoriaus veikimas. Bet koks pažadinimo įvykis (MAC, pagrindinis kompiuteris, RTC laikmatis arba išorinis pertraukimas) pažadins lustą.
  • Gilaus miego režimas: veikia tik RTC atmintis ir išoriniai įrenginiai. „Wi-Fi“ ir „Bluetooth“ ryšio duomenys, saugomi RTC. ULP koprocesorius gali veikti.
  • Hibernacijos režimas: 8 MHz generatorius ir integruotas koprocesorius ULP yra išjungti. RTC atmintis, skirta atkurti maitinimo šaltinį, yra išjungta. Tik vienas RTC laikrodžio laikmatis, esantis lėtame laikrodyje, ir kai kurie RTC GPIO darbe. RTC RTC laikrodis arba laikmatis gali pabusti iš GPIO sulaikytosios veiksenos režimo.

Gilaus miego režimas

  • Susijęs miego režimas: energijos taupymo režimo perjungimas iš aktyvaus, modemo miego, lengvo miego režimo. CPU, Wi-Fi, Bluetooth ir radijo iš anksto nustatytas laiko intervalas, kurį reikia pažadinti, kad būtų užtikrintas Wi-Fi / Bluetooth ryšys.
  • Itin mažos galios jutiklio stebėjimo metodai: pagrindinė sistema yra gilaus miego režimas, ULP koprocesorius periodiškai atidaromas arba uždaromas jutiklio duomenims matuoti. Jutiklis matuoja duomenis, ULP koprocesorius nusprendžia, ar pažadinti pagrindinę sistemą.

Veikia įvairiais energijos vartojimo režimais: 5 LENTELĖ

M5STACK-M5Core2-V1.1-ESP32 IoT Development-Kit-FIG-9

Bet kokie pakeitimai ar modifikacijos, kurių aiškiai nepatvirtino už atitiktį atsakinga šalis, gali panaikinti vartotojo teisę naudoti įrangą. Šis įrenginys atitinka FCC taisyklių 15 dalį. Eksploatacijai taikomos dvi toliau nurodytos sąlygos

  1. Šis prietaisas negali sukelti žalingų trukdžių ir
  2.  Šis įrenginys turi priimti bet kokius gaunamus trikdžius, įskaitant trikdžius, kurie gali sukelti nepageidaujamą veikimą.

Pastaba

  • Ši įranga buvo išbandyta ir nustatyta, kad ji atitinka B klasės skaitmeninio įrenginio apribojimus pagal FCC taisyklių 15 dalį. Šios ribos sukurtos siekiant užtikrinti pagrįstą apsaugą nuo žalingų trukdžių įrengiant gyvenamosiose patalpose.
  • Ši įranga generuoja, naudoja ir gali skleisti radijo dažnių energiją ir, jei ji sumontuota ir naudojama ne pagal instrukcijas, gali sukelti žalingų radijo ryšio trikdžių. Tačiau nėra garantijos, kad tam tikrame įrengime nebus trikdžių.
  • Jei ši įranga sukelia žalingus radijo ar televizijos priėmimo trikdžius, kuriuos galima nustatyti išjungiant ir įjungiant įrangą, vartotojas raginamas pabandyti ištaisyti trikdžius viena ar keliomis iš toliau nurodytų priemonių.
    • Perkelkite arba perkelkite priėmimo anteną.
    • Padidinkite atstumą tarp įrangos ir imtuvo.
    • Įjunkite įrangą į kitokios grandinės lizdą nei imtuvas.
    • Dėl pagalbos kreipkitės į pardavėją arba patyrusį radijo/televizijos techniką.
  • Ši įranga atitinka FCC spinduliuotės poveikio ribas, nustatytas nekontroliuojamai aplinkai. Ši įranga turi būti sumontuota ir naudojama mažiausiai 20 cm atstumu tarp radiatoriaus ir jūsų kūno.

Konfigūruoti WIFI
UIFlow teikia tiek offl.ine, tiek web programuotojo veruon. Kai naudojate web versija, turime sukonfigūruoti įrenginio WiFi ryšį. Toliau aprašomi du būdai, kaip konfigūruoti įrenginio \Vlfi ryšį (Bum konfigūracija ir AP viešosios interneto prieigos taško konfigūracija).

Įrašyti konfigūraciją „WiFi“{rekomenduoti)
IOU!Flow-1.5.4 ir ankstesnės versijos gali rašyti „WiFi inlormat1on“ tiesiogiai per M5Burner .M5STACK-M5Core2-V1.1-ESP32 IoT Development-Kit-FIG-4

AP viešosios interneto prieigos taško konfigūracija „WiFi“.

  1. Paspauskite ir spauskite maitinimo mygtuką kairėje, kad įjungtumėte įrenginį. Jei W1FI nesukonfigūruotas, sistema automatiškai pereis į tinklo konfigūravimo režimą, kai bus įjungtas pirmą kartą. Tarkime, kad norite iš naujo įjungti tinklo konfigūracijos režimą ir pakeisti kitų programų vykdymą. galite kreiptis į toliau pateiktą operaciją. Pakeiskite UIFlow logotipą, kuris pasirodo paleidžiant, greitai spustelėkite pradžios mygtuką (centrinis MS mygtukas), kad patektumėte į konfigūracijos puslapį. Paspauskite mygtuką dešinėje fiuzeliažo pusėje, kad perjungtumėte parinktį į Setting, ir paspauskite pradžios mygtuką, kad patvirtintumėte. Paspauskite dešinįjį mygtuką, kad perjungtumėte parinktį į WIFi nustatymą, paspauskite pradžios mygtuką, kad patvirtintumėte, ir pradėkite konfigūraciją. M5STACK-M5Core2-V1.1-ESP32 IoT Development-Kit-FIG-5
  2. Sėkmingai prisijungę prie viešosios interneto prieigos taško savo mobiliajame telefone, atidarykite mobiliojo telefono naršyklę, kad nuskaitytumėte ekrane esantį QR kodą arba tiesiogiai pasietumėte 192.188.4.1. įeikite į puslapį ir užpildykite savo asmeninę WIFI informaciją. ir spustelėkite „Konfigūruoti“, kad įrašytumėte „WiFi“ informaciją. Įrenginys wm automatiškai paleidžiamas iš naujo po sėkmingo konfigūravimo ir įjungiamas programavimo režimas.

Pastaba: Specialūs simboliai, tokie kaip „tarpas“, neleidžiami sukonfigūruotame W,Fi 1rtformat10n.M5STACK-M5Core2-V1.1-ESP32 IoT Development-Kit-FIG-6

BLEUART funkcijos aprašymas 
Užmegzkite „Bluetooth“ ryšį ir įjunkite „Bluetooth“ perdavimo paslaugą.M5STACK-M5Core2-V1.1-ESP32 IoT Development-Kit-FIG-7

Instrukcijos
„Bluetooth“ jungtis ir „scad co/off“ valdymo šviesos diodasM5STACK-M5Core2-V1.1-ESP32 IoT Development-Kit-FIG-8

Dokumentai / Ištekliai

M5STACK M5Core2 V1.1 ESP32 IoT kūrimo rinkinys [pdfNaudotojo vadovas
M5CORE2V11, 2AN3WM5CORE2V11, M5Core2 V1.1 ESP32 IoT kūrimo rinkinys, M5Core2 V1.1, ESP32 IoT kūrimo rinkinys, IoT kūrimo rinkinys

Nuorodos

Palikite komentarą

Jūsų el. pašto adresas nebus skelbiamas. Privalomi laukai pažymėti *